Being
the largest city of Bahrain, Manamah prides itself by being called a
strong trading hub in the region. Although it was founded alongside its
twin city Muharraq in the 1800s, Manamah came to be the gateway to the
Bahrain Island while Muharraq claimed its title as the country’s capital
till 1920s due to its defensive location. Later on, Manamah became the
mercantile capital of Bahrain and has ever since held that position with
much dignity and prominence due to its ever expanding culture based on
technological and economic advancements.
